Abstract
For the last five years, The CBBL has been financed in his research regarding the understanding of Functional Movements and Conformational Changes of Proteins related with diseases as: neurodegenerative pathologies, Diabetes, HIV/AIDS and Cancer, using several techniques as: Normal Modes, Molecular Dynamics, Coarse Grained Models, QMMM and Machine Learning. This seminar will present two different studies about Conformational Changes and Functional Movements using different protocols. In the first study, we applied NM, MD and CG to obtain and characterize of transition states of Prion and proposed a aggregation model. In the second study, we apply the combination of MD, NM and QM/MM to identify conformational changes or movements reduce the reaction barrier of HIV Protease.
